The Bosch Rexroth Indramat MDD025B-N-100-N2G-040GE1 is part of the MDD Synchronous Motors series and is designed for use with digital drive controllers. This motor features a nominal speed of 10,000 min⁻¹, a continuous torque at standstill of 0.60 Nm, and comes equipped with a 1.0 Nm blocking brake. It has resolver feedback, a 40 mm centering diameter, and a standard plain shaft with a shaft seal.

Product Description:
The MDD025B-N-100-N2G-040GE1 is a compact synchronous servo motor produced by Bosch Rexroth Indramat for the MDD Synchronous Motors series. Built for digital drive controllers, it transforms precisely metered current into accurate shaft rotation that supports fine-resolution positioning tasks in automated machinery. Its compact frame and wiring layout help the unit fit near sensors, actuators, and adjacent motion components where installation space is limited. This arrangement makes the motor suitable for tightly packed axes that still require responsive and repeatable motion.
At a nominal speed of 10,000 rpm, the rotor can sustain a continuous standstill torque of 0.60 Nm, giving the drive a predictable margin for holding and low-speed moves. Loss of mains power is managed by a blocking brake that delivers 1.0 Nm of static torque so vertically mounted loads can remain stationary. Mounting concentricity is set by a 40 mm centering diameter, and the rotor-stator assembly is balanced to the standard grade to help keep vibration within normal servo limits at high speed. The power and feedback leads exit on the left side through a connecting cable with a coupling unit, which supports orderly cable routing and reduces strain on the connection.
The motor uses frame size 025 and length code B, producing a short body that helps reduce axis mass for rapid acceleration. Motion data are returned through resolver feedback, allowing closed-loop control when the axis changes speed or position quickly. A plain shaft is supplied on the drive end, while the opposite face remains undrilled to save space and inertia. Contaminants are blocked by a shaft seal, which helps keep fine dust or stray coolant away from the bearings. The aluminum housing also helps keep the assembly light for compact motion systems.
